<paragraph pageId="8" pageNumber="95">Description.</paragraph>
|
||
<paragraph pageId="8" pageNumber="95">Wingspan: 8.3-10.0 mm.</paragraph>
|
||
<paragraph pageId="8" pageNumber="95">
|
||
Head: With numerous white scales on dorsal surface. Labial palpus dark brown. Antenna brown, about 1.2
|
||
<normalizedToken originalValue="×">x</normalizedToken>
|
||
as long as forewing. Female proboscis with a large number of trichoid sensilla; sensilla as long as width of proboscis, denser toward base.
|
||
</paragraph>
|
||
<paragraph pageId="8" pageNumber="95">
|
||
Thorax: White dorsally. Forewing brown with narrow white band on dorsum from base to 2/3 of entire length; three narrow white bands beginning at dorsal margin near 1/2 to 3/4 length of wing and extending obliquely toward wing apex, terminating before reaching mid-width of wing; dull white spots scattered on costal half; a narrow silver band with metallic reflection extending from costa to dorsum at 5/6 length; distal 1/6 orange-brown with black dot centrally, franked by short white band near dorsum; distal end fringed with narrow white band; cilia grayish brown. Hindwing brown, 0.8
|
||
<normalizedToken originalValue="×">x</normalizedToken>
|
||
length of forewing; cilia grayish brown.
|
||
</paragraph>
|
||
<paragraph pageId="8" pageNumber="95">Male genitalia: Tegumen elongated rounded triangular. Cucullus rounded rectangular at distal half, projected outwardly at basal half with dense spines on outer surface of the projection; ventral margin of basal half folded inwardly; inner surface covered with numerous hairs. Sacculus rounded triangular, 2/3 length of cucullus, with row of long spines on ventral inner surface running parallel to ventral margin and continuing to a cluster of spines at apex. Vinculum U-shaped; saccus oblong, as long as vinculum. Aedeagus slightly curved dorsally at middle, with a pair of half-moon-shaped projections ventrally near mid-length, dorsally with parallel longitudinal ridges for entire length, dilated slightly at apex.</paragraph>
|
||
<paragraph lastPageId="9" lastPageNumber="96" pageId="8" pageNumber="95">
|
||
Female genitalia: Lamella postvaginalis rigid, crescent-shaped, curved ventrally, with a pair of teeth on posterior margin, as broad as and 0.5
|
||
<normalizedToken originalValue="×">x</normalizedToken>
|
||
length of seventh sternite. Antrum 1.2
|
||
<normalizedToken originalValue="×">x</normalizedToken>
|
||
length of lamella postvaginalis, with a pair of sclerotized parallel ridges continuing to ductus bursae. Ductus bursae as long as antrum, with longitudinal parallel ridges to 2/3 of its length. Corpus bursae elongate oval; signum absent.
|
||
<pageBreakToken pageId="9" pageNumber="96" start="start">Apophyses</pageBreakToken>
|
||
posteriores 1.4
|
||
<normalizedToken originalValue="×">x</normalizedToken>
|
||
length of apophyses anteriores. Ovipositor dentate laterally, angular at apex.
|
||
</paragraph>
